This firm currently seeks a high achieving Senior Tax Manager who has a minimum of 8 years' experience working with US private clients who have some sort of international tax filing considerations (individual or corporate):

You will be involved in the following work:
Responsible for reviewing and final sign off of all international compliance tax forms such as 5471, 8865, 8858, 8621, 926, 1116, 1118, 2555, 3520, 3520-A, 1040NR, TDF 90.22-1 (Now FinCen 114).
Assisting clients with a range of US tax issues, including branch profits tax, withholding tax, foreign investments in real estate, foreign tax credits, controlled foreign corporations (CFCs), passive foreign investment companies (PFICs), corporate reorganizations, and state taxes.
Manage US and sometimes UK tax compliance for a large portfolio of clients including high-net worth individuals and individuals on employer sponsored assignments.
Analysing various Double Tax Treaties and the sourcing of compensation, investment and other income.
